2026 is off to a rocketing start for the Hog Roast Westcliff-on-Sea catering team as we kicked off January with a truly massive event at Westminster Chapel where our catering manager Dohnis proved his credentials in style while seamlessly and effectively catering for well over 500 hundred guests.
An event for one of our many corporate partners operating in South Essex, this corporate event brought together friends and family of the company, racking the guest list up to a whopping 525. As a caterer, that means 525 mouths to feed, meaning at a minimum 525 dishes to cook up. It is our goal with any event, be it big or small, to never have a loss of quality in sacrifice for quantity. So, even with over 500 dishes to cook, Dohnis and the Hog Roast Westcliffe-on-Sea team knew that each and every dish – each and every guest experience – had to be just as good as the one before.
So, Dohnis proved himself a worthy leader of the Hog Roast Westcliffe-on-Sea kitchen once again by picking a straightforward option of hot dogs and sauces for the kids in attendance (of which there were 35) and then serving up a relatively simple yet brilliant catering option of rolls and wraps with either pulled pork or BBQ pulled jackfruit (for the veggie option) as a filling. From one hog roast we can dish out meat for about a hundred people, so a couple extra big ones and we had enough for everyone to get the very best pork in all of British catering – all served within 90 minutes and fully fresh, too.
The star of the show was our new signature double pocket wrap – a combination of juicy pulled pork on one side balanced out by our homemade sage and onion stuffing loaded into the other side. A juicy, crisp, and delicious dining option that can see even 500 guests well served in record time!
